Matching program types to genuine work and life
The phrase emergency treatment and cpr course North Lakes covers a spectrum. Choosing the ideal one depends on your work, your prior knowing, and the situations you are more than likely to deal with. I see four common pathways.
The first is HLTAID009 Supply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ation, the classic mouth-to-mouth resuscitation course North Lakes homeowners publication for annual refreshers. The contact time can be as short as one to two hours for the practical session if you finish the theory online. It focuses on adult, kid, and baby compressions, rescue breaths, AED usage, and choking monitoring. For childcare workers and swimming trainers, the baby component is non-negotiable.
Second is HLTAID011 Offer Emergency Treatment, the standard for many workplaces. With blended distribution, anticipate 2 to four hours in person. We cover injury treatment, taking care of shock, cracks, sprains, burns, asthma and anaphylaxis, seizures, and how to turn over to paramedics effectively. This is the pleasant spot for individuals that want a robust first aid certificate North Lakes employers identify throughout industries.
Third is HLTAID012 Offer First Aid in an education and care setting. This includes additional material on asthma and anaphylaxis and suits educators, early childhood years team, and OSHC groups. Lots of North Lakes colleges timetable group sessions onsite before term starts, which conserves traveling and makes conformity clean.
Finally, there are innovative abilities and industry-specific refreshers, such as oxygen treatment, progressed resuscitation, and work-related emergency treatment. While less public sessions run locally, mobile instructors can come to you. For organizations in the North Lakes Organization Park, on-site group training throughout a quiet afternoon usually defeats sending out staff offsite in ones and twos.

The value of hands-on practice, even when time is scarce
Some students get here asking if they can simply do the on-line portion. I comprehend the impulse. When your diary is complete, the couch and a laptop computer sound alluring. The problem is that CPR is a physical ability. It calls for body weight, rhythm, and strategy. I have watched hundreds of initial compressions. Even certain adults usually begin also superficial or also quick. With a trainer and a responses manikin, you adjust until the metrics go eco-friendly. That tweak can not happen in a slideshow.
Realistic drills additionally reduce hesitation. In North Lakes emergency treatment program sessions, we rehearse calling Triple Zero with concise details, rearranging a person from car seat to ground, and keeping compressions going while a colleague establishes the AED. You will certainly sweat a little. You will feel your knees and wrists. That small discomfort, when discovered, suggests you will relocate quicker and much safer if an associate or member of the family falls down in a shopping centre or at home.
What employers in North Lakes seek on your certificate
Hiring managers and conformity officers frequently check 3 things: the system code, the day of problem, and the service provider's extent. For first aid and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ation courses North Lakes, the present system codes most employers recognize are HLTAID009, HLTAID011, and HLTAID012, with HLTAID015 for sophisticated resuscitation. The certification ought to provide the unit, the day, and the registered training organisation's number. Lots of organizations additionally ask whether your CPR is less than twelve month old, even if the wider emergency treatment unit stays legitimate for three years. It is worth scheduling a cpr programs North Lakes refresher yearly to keep the card current.
Electronic certifications are typical now, often sent within 24 hr certainly conclusion as soon as assessments are marked. If your human resources team needs it very same day, ask beforehand. Some carriers finalise outcomes instantly when all evidence is collected easily, which assists if you are onboarding to a new duty on Monday.

The instance for recurring refresher courses and how to make them painless
Skills degeneration is real. Research studies recommend mouth-to-mouth resuscitation performance drops within 3 to 6 months if you do not exercise. That is why a yearly mouth-to-mouth resuscitation North Lakes refresher is greater than a conformity checkbox. The technique is to make these repeat brows through frictionless. Book the next one prior to you leave when your calendar is open. Add a pointer on your phone six weeks out. If you train as a team, rotate two or three team every month as opposed to sending out all twenty at once. That spreads out expertise and prevents a mad shuffle in June.
Many providers now use micro-reminders by e-mail or application. A two-minute video clip on compressions, a brief punctual on asthma inhaler technique, a fast quiz on stroke acknowledgment. Quick pushes keep knowledge fresh without overwhelming you.
